(plz cc me on your replies, i'm not on pgsql-hackers for some reason.) http://www.vix.com/~vixie/results-psql.png shows a gnuplot of the wall time of 70K executions of "pgcat" (shown below) using a CIDR key and TEXT value. (this is for storing the MAPS RSS, which we presently have in flat files.) i've benchmarked this against a flat directory with IP addresses as filenames, and against a deep directory with squid/netnews style hashing (127/0/0/1.txt) and while it's way more predictable than either of those, there's nothing in my test framework which explains the 1.5s mode shown in the above *.png file. anybody know what i could be doing wrong? (i'm also wondering why SELECT takes ~250ms whereas INSERT takes ~70ms... seems counterintuitive, unless TOAST is doing a LOT better than i think.) furthermore, are there any plans to offer a better libpq interface to INSERT? the things i'm doing now to quote the text, and the extra copy i'm maintaining, are painful. arbitrary-sized "text" attributes are a huge boon -- we would never have considered using postgres for MAPS RSS (or RBL) with "large objects".
